Common TaskCat.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with TaskCat.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with TaskCat.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• TaskCat.exe - Bad Image Error:: This alert is displayed when Windows fails to execute TaskCat.exe due to its corruption, or the related DLL file being absent or damaged.
  • Access is Denied: This alert emerges when the system prohibits access to a requested file or resource. This could be because of inadequate user rights, conflicts in file ownership, or stringent file permissions.
  • TaskCat.exe File Not Executing: Sometimes, despite double-clicking an .exe file, the program might not start. This could be due to incorrect file permissions, system issues, or conflicting software.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This error message is displayed when the system encounters a severe error that causes it to crash. This could be due to hardware issues, driver conflicts, or severe software bugs that affect the operating system's stability.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This error message appears when an application wasn't able to start correctly, often due to issues in the software itself, corrupted files, or problems with Windows registry.

How to Remove TaskCat.exe

In case the removal of the TaskCat.exe file is required, the ensuing steps should be adhered to. It's always important to be cautious when altering system files, as unintended modifications could trigger unforeseen system reactions.

  1. Find the File: The initial step involves locating TaskCat.exe on your system. The File Explorer search feature can assist you in doing this.

  2. Secure Your Data: Always back up essential data before changing your system files. This is a critical safety step.

  3. Eliminate the File: After identifying the location of TaskCat.exe, you can delete it. Just right-click the file and select Delete. This action moves the file to your Recycle Bin.

  4. Finalize the Deletion: To ensure TaskCat.exe is completely eradicated from your system, you should empty your Recycle Bin. Right-click on the Recycle Bin and choose Empty Recycle Bin.

  5. Verify System Health: Conduct a comprehensive system scan with a reliable antivirus tool once you've disposed of the file. This ensures there are no remnants of the file lurking in your system.

Note: It's important to mention that if TaskCat.exe is associated with the a program, its removal may impact its functionality. If any issues arise post deletion, consider reinstalling the program or consult a technology professional for guidance.
